Koyorad Auto Trans Oil Cooler

SKU: 17CEV | MPN:  EC0007J
Only 2 units left
Sale price$127.94 USD

KoyoRad EC0007J Auto Trans Oil Cooler
No Core Charge Required
Parts Interchange: EC0007J, EC0007J, 32238001309, 322 38001 309